Skip to content

Commit

Permalink
Small simplifications
Browse files Browse the repository at this point in the history
  • Loading branch information
flack committed Jan 17, 2024
1 parent 3420f69 commit 8740f6b
Showing 1 changed file with 8 additions and 15 deletions.
23 changes: 8 additions & 15 deletions src/midcom/httpkernel/subscriber.php
Original file line number Diff line number Diff line change
Expand Up @@ -29,8 +29,6 @@
*/
class subscriber implements EventSubscriberInterface
{
private bool $initialized = false;

public static function getSubscribedEvents()
{
return [
Expand All @@ -52,12 +50,10 @@ private function initialize(Request $request)
return $response;
}

// This checks for the unittest case
if (!$request->attributes->has('context')) {
// Initialize Context Storage
$context = midcom_core_context::enter(midcom_connection::get_url('uri'));
$request->attributes->set('context', $context);
}
// Initialize Context Storage
$context = midcom_core_context::enter(midcom_connection::get_url('uri'));
$request->attributes->set('context', $context);

// Initialize the UI message stack from session
$midcom->uimessages->initialize($request);

Expand All @@ -68,16 +64,13 @@ private function initialize(Request $request)
public function on_request(RequestEvent $event)
{
$request = $event->getRequest();
if (!$this->initialized) {
$this->initialized = true;
if ($response = $this->initialize($request)) {
$event->setResponse($response);
return;
}
if ( $event->isMainRequest()
&& $response = $this->initialize($request)) {
$event->setResponse($response);
return;
}

$resolver = new resolver($request);

if ($resolver->process_midcom()) {
return;
}
Expand Down

0 comments on commit 8740f6b

Please sign in to comment.